    I think most of the time all they get is an authorization number to put on the form but not 100% sure. Here in KY since I have my CCDW they don't even have to call it in, just put that info on the form since KY automatically runs you every 30 days to make sure they don't have to revoke your CCDW.

    Took the new FPC to the range yesterday, it was awesome! Sent the paper out to 20 ft just to test the gun's function and see how close my laser boresight got the Romeo 7 dialed. First shot was about 3/4" from the aim point, second shot just made the hole 25% bigger, 3rd shot went thru the same hole. Went out to 30 and 45 ft. and just a few clicks on the dot got me dead on. Need to add the 3x magnifier to be any good past 60 ft with my shit vision. Shot over 100 rounds with no issues. I do wish the stock was adjustable, and towards the end my bony shoulder was feeling the hits from the hard plastic stock. An inch thick foam rubber pad would address both I think.
    Also took the TX22, along with the 4 new mags with Wingman +5 extensions. That POS was worse than last outing... FTF jams every few rounds on all 7 mags. Don't know if it's worth sending back to Taurus a second time or just having a local gunsmith take a look.
